Ingredients

(Tip: You’ll find the full list of ingredients and measurements in the recipe card below.)

  • Popped popcorn (freshly popped or microwave)
  • Granulated sugar
  • Unsalted butter
  • Water
  • Strawberry extract or strawberry gelatin mix
  • Light corn syrup (optional for extra gloss and crunch)
  • Red or pink food coloring (optional)

Directions

  1. Prepare the popcorn:
    Pop the popcorn using your preferred method. Spread it out on a parchment-lined baking sheet and remove any unpopped kernels.
  2. Make the strawberry coating:
    In a saucepan over medium heat, combine sugar, butter, water, and strawberry extract (or gelatin mix). If using corn syrup and food coloring, add them now. Stir constantly until the mixture reaches a simmer and the sugar is dissolved.
  3. Coat the popcorn:
    Pour the hot strawberry syrup over the popcorn. Quickly and gently toss to evenly coat all the kernels.
  4. Set the popcorn:
    Let the popcorn cool completely at room temperature for 12 hours. For an extra crisp finish, you can bake it at 250°F (120°C) for 1520 minutes, stirring once halfway through.
  5. Serve or store:
    Once dry and crispy, break apart any clumps and serve.

Variations

  • Use freeze-dried strawberries: Blend into powder and toss with buttered popcorn for a natural, fruity finish.
  • Add white chocolate drizzle: Melt and drizzle over cooled popcorn for added decadence.
  • Swap the flavor: Use raspberry, cherry, or cotton candy extracts for a fun twist.
  • Use colored candy melts: Instead of syrup, melt pink or red candy melts and mix with popcorn for a quicker version.

Storage/reheating

  • Storage: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days.
  • Freezing: Not recommended, as it can affect the texture.
  • Reheating: No reheating necessary—serve at room temperature.

FAQs

Can I use microwave popcorn for this recipe?

Yes, just be sure to choose a plain or lightly salted variety and remove all unpopped kernels.

What can I use instead of strawberry extract?

You can use strawberry gelatin mix or freeze-dried strawberry powder for flavor.

Can I make this without food coloring?

Yes, it will still taste delicious but won’t have the vibrant pink color.

How do I make it extra crunchy?

Bake the coated popcorn at a low temperature for 1520 minutes after coating.

Is this recipe gluten-free?

Yes, if all your ingredients (especially flavorings) are certified gluten-free.

Can I use air-popped popcorn?

Absolutely! It’s a healthier option and works great in this recipe.

How long does strawberry popcorn last?

It stays fresh for about 5 days in a sealed container at room temperature.

Can I use other flavors?

Definitely! Try other extracts like cherry, vanilla, or cotton candy.

Is this good for gifting?

Yes, it’s perfect in clear treat bags or decorative tins for holidays and events.

Can kids help make this?

Yes, but they should avoid handling the hot syrup. Let them help toss or decorate the cooled popcorn.

Description

Strawberry Popcorn is a sweet, crunchy snack made with freshly popped popcorn coated in a vibrant strawberry glaze. It’s perfect for parties, holidays, movie nights, or anytime you’re craving a fruity twist on classic caramel corn. Kids love it, and it’s super easy to make!



  • Prep the popcorn:
    Pop your popcorn using an air popper or stovetop. Remove any unpopped kernels and place the popcorn in a large mixing bowl. Preheat oven to 250°F (120°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or a silicone mat.

  • Make the strawberry coating:
    In a small saucepan over medium heat, combine sugar, butter, corn syrup, salt, and strawberry gelatin. Stir constantly until the mixture comes to a boil.

  • Simmer and flavor:
    Let it boil for 4 minutes without stirring. Remove from heat and stir in vanilla extract. Add food coloring if desired for extra color.

  • Coat the popcorn:
    Quickly pour the strawberry mixture over the popcorn. Gently toss with a spatula until the popcorn is evenly coated.

  • Bake:
    Spread the coated popcorn evenly on the prepared baking sheet. Bake for 30 minutes, stirring every 10 minutes to ensure even coating.

 


Notes

  • For an extra strawberry kick, drizzle with melted white chocolate and sprinkle with freeze-dried strawberry pieces.

  • Store in an airtight container for up to a week.

  • You can use microwave popcorn as a shortcut—just make sure it’s plain or lightly salted.
